Daily (10 minutes at shift change)
1. Check the liquid level: The tank liquid level should be ≥30% to prevent dry grinding. If the liquid level drops suddenly, check for leaks first.
2. Listen for sounds: No metal friction or cavitation noise. Immediately reduce the load if any abnormality occurs.
3. Feel the temperature: Bearing seat ≤70°C, mechanical seal gland ≤60°C; if hot, cool with water first.
4. Check for leaks: Mechanical seal, flange, and hose. If visible leakage is >3 drops/minute, address it.
5. Record the pressure: Compare the outlet pressure with the previous day's pressure. If the fluctuation is >±5%, check the filter or valve opening.
Weekly
6. Turn the motor: Turn off the power and manually turn the coupling 2–3 turns until there is no binding.
7. Tighten the bolts: Retighten the base, flange, and motor terminals diagonally.
8. Clean the filter: Disassemble and clean the suction filter to
remove all coal slime, crystals, and fibers. 9. Add oil/grease: Fill the
bearing housing and gearbox oil level to 2/3; for mechanical seals with
oil cups, add 2 drops daily.
10. Test insulation: Motor-to-ground ≥0.5 MΩ. If below, dry or repair.
Monthly
11. Change flushing fluid: Refresh the mechanical seal flushing tank
(Plan 32/54) every 500 hours or monthly to prevent crystallization and
blockage.
12. Calibrate safety valves: Increase pressure to the set value, and ensure smooth opening and closing, without sticking.
13. Check seals: Magnetic pump isolation sleeves, diaphragm pump
diaphragms, and screw pump bushings. Replace immediately if cracks ≥1
mm.
14. Clean coolers: If scale thickness >1 mm, circulate 5% citric acid for 2 hours to prevent overheating.
Quarterly
15. Dynamic balancing: Dynamically balance the impeller and rotor,
ensuring vibration ≤4.5 mm/s. Any exceeding the standard should be
returned to the factory. 16. Material Inspection: PMI testing is
performed in a chloride ion environment to confirm that there is no
mixing of 316L/2205/C276.
17. Standby Switchover: The primary and secondary pumps are alternately
operated for 30 minutes to prevent seizure from prolonged idle time.
Annually
18. Overhaul: Every 4000 hours of operation or once a year, the
impeller, sleeve, seal, and bearings are disassembled and inspected. All
wearing parts are replaced, and the pump is re-balanced and subjected
to a hydrostatic test.

Company Profile
Petrel's foreign trade share takes around 50%. To meet standards and requirement of different foreign clients, Petrel continuously improve its production management.
Petrel improves product management system by ensuring the trackability of raw material sourcing, heat treatment process, and machining accuracy. The codes on key parts allow Petrel to track which steel mill supplies the material, which factory conducts the heat treatment, inspection records of fine machining, etc.
To sustain products' high quality, Petrel heavily invests its calibration lab by importing various inspection equipment, such as spectrometers, Brinell hardness gauges, coordinate measuring machine, etc.
To promote and sustain a high level of productivity and safety, Petrel also pays attention to employee training, which includes 6s lean methodology, instructions of equipment, standards, requirement of production process, etc.
